Maintaining a flawless complexion is not solely dependent on genetics—it demands a committed skin maintenance regimen. Since the skin is our most expansive organ, it faces constant external aggressors, sun exposure, and other influences that impact its condition. A structured regimen that includes washing, hydration, masques, serums, and facial oils is key for maintaining a vibrant and elastic complexion.
Daily cleansing lays the groundwork of any effective skincare routine. Over time, the surface gathers impurities, sebum, and pollutants, which, if not removed, can lead to clogged pores, dullness, and skin issues. A good face wash removes these residues, ensuring a fresh complexion. However, it’s crucial to use a non-irritating cleanser suited for one’s skin type so as not to cause dehydration. Harsh products may strip natural oils, resulting in sensitivity. Individuals prone to irritation must choose fragrance-free options. Oily complexions should consider foaming cleansers that regulate oil without excessive dryness. Moisture-rich products work best for parched complexions, providing moisture retention.
After washing, hydration is a must in any skincare routine. Moisturizers serve to replenish hydration, preventing dryness and irritation. Every skin type, hydration is necessary. Oily or acne-prone individuals should select oil-free hydrators that nourish without clogging pores. For dry skin, an intense moisture-locking product can work wonders. People with fluctuating skin needs benefits from balanced hydration to prevent excess shine and flaking. Over time, a good moisturizer ensures soft, radiant texture.
